Mike, I think you might be better off on a charter. Many of the kids don't have gear and even if they do, what kind of shape would it be in? You'll spend the better part of the day fixing their tackle. With a charter, you'll still be helping to untangle messes, but you'll also have the added bonus of gear and mates to help out with. And, in the long run, more of the boys will probably end up catching fish and having a good time. If it were me, I'd consider bringing them on a Scup or bottom fishing trip where they're almost sure to keep busy catching. The other thing you wouldn't have to worry about as with shore fishing would be some of them getting bored and wandering off. Just my thoughts. Sounds like a good idea though to get them involved in the fishing.
